一、Hql 入门 1、实体类: package learn.hibernate.bean; import java.util.Date;
import java.util.HashSet;
import java.util.Set; /** * 持久化类设计 * 注意: * 持久化类通常建议要有一个...
分类:
Web程序 时间:
2015-02-16 19:29:30
阅读次数:
179
文章地址:http://blog.csdn.net/yuliqi0429/article/details/41911421
分类:
其他好文 时间:
2015-02-14 01:18:38
阅读次数:
138
通常使用的Hibernate通常是三种:hql查询,QBC查询和QBE查询: 1、QBE(Qurey By Example)检索方式 QBE是最简单的,但是功能也是最弱的,QBE的功能不是特别强大,仅在某些场合下有用。一个典型的使用场合就是在查...
分类:
Web程序 时间:
2015-02-11 16:52:08
阅读次数:
175
HQL(Hibernate Query Language)。传统的SQL语言采用的是结构化的查询方法,而这种方法对于对象形式存在的数据却无能为力。为此,Hibernate为我们提供了一种语法类似SQL的语言,这既是HQL(Hibernate查询语言),和SQL不同的是,HQL是一种面向对象的查询语言,它可以查询以对象形式存在的数据。
SQL本身是非常强大的查询语言。当SQL拥有处理面向对象数据的...
分类:
Web程序 时间:
2015-02-09 14:10:04
阅读次数:
202
上文介绍Hibernate基本的增删改查,本例将介绍更实用的批量增删改查的操作的实现。本文中增删改查的操作,仅供参考。如果读者需要应用到实际的应用场景需要的话,需要在此基础上扩展与丰富。
【转载使用,请注明出处:http://blog.csdn.net/mahoking】
在学习本例时,需要扩展一下Hibernate中Session的知识。Hibernate中的Session是一...
分类:
Web程序 时间:
2015-02-07 14:31:52
阅读次数:
200
1:对比原生sql查询和 hql查询 返回结果的类型count:sql: select count(0) from xxx where .... 返回 BigIntegerhql: select count(0) from xxx where .... 返回 Longmax:sql: select ...
分类:
Web程序 时间:
2015-02-06 23:14:52
阅读次数:
294
当我们在写Hibernate Orm组件的时候,经常会遇到分页查询这种操作,分页查询的原理不在熬述,比较重要的一点是需要计算查询的总数count,大部分人还是采用传统的hql/sql字符串截取或者拼接等方式实现。下面给出的代码是通过字符串模板、正则匹配等方式实现的,直接上代码:
public class QueryTemplateUtil {
public static final St...
分类:
数据库 时间:
2015-02-06 13:18:17
阅读次数:
218
1. 两者分别是什么? Apache Hive是一个构建在Hadoop基础设施之上的数据仓库。通过Hive可以使用HQL语言查询存放在HDFS上的数据。HQL是一种类SQL语言,这种语言最终被转化为Map/Reduce. 虽然Hive提供了SQL查询功能,但是Hive不能够进行交互查询--因为它只能...
分类:
其他好文 时间:
2015-02-04 23:15:56
阅读次数:
433
引言: 在基于SpringData/JPA来快速开发若干功能过程中,碰到了table is not Mapped问题,经过一番辛苦的调试测试之后,才发现了一个@Entity的属性name的妙用。...
分类:
移动开发 时间:
2015-02-04 14:38:55
阅读次数:
379
1. 查询整个映射对象所有字段Java代码//直接from查询出来的是一个映射对象,即:查询整个映射对象所有字段 Stringhql="from Users"; Query query = session.createQuery(hql); List users = query.list();...
分类:
Web程序 时间:
2015-02-03 21:21:17
阅读次数:
207